Isn't the 68% supposed to be in between the 12 and 16?
beaner4life 2 years ago
No, the rule of thumb (or empirical rules) says 68% of the data from a normal distribution should lie within 1 standard deviation of the mean. For mean = 14 and s = 4, that means between 10 and 18.
